Tight Security As Adeleke, Appointees Attend Accord Governorship Primary In Osun

Osun State Governor, Senator Ademola Adeleke, his deputy, Kola Adewusi, and top government officials were present on Wednesday as the Accord Party began its governorship primary in Osogbo ahead of the 2026 governorship election.

The exercise, held under tight security, saw armed policemen and operatives of the Department of State Services (DSS) stationed at strategic locations around the venue to maintain order.

Officials of the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) also monitored the proceedings.

The governor was accompanied by a retinue of state officials, including commissioners, special advisers, and senior special assistants, signalling strong institutional support for his new political platform.

Also in attendance was the National Chairman of the Accord Party, Barrister Maxwell Mgbudem, who led the delegation from the party’s national headquarters.

Naijaonpoint earlier reported that Governor Adeleke officially dumped the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) and joined the Accord Party on Tuesday.

At the Government House Banquet Hall in Osogbo, Adeleke declared his intention to seek re-election in 2026 on the Accord platform, citing internal crises within the PDP as his reason for the switch.

Adeleke said, “I joined the Accord Party more than a month ago, precisely on November 6th, as a platform to seek re-election in 2026. This was after weeks of consultation and deliberations with stakeholders and opinion leaders.

“Stakeholders and residents of Osun state are aware of why we are taking this important decision. We intend to pursue a second term in office on the platform of the Accord Party to complete ongoing delivery of good governance and democratic dividends, which have been applauded at home and abroad.

“We opted for the Accord Party because its mission of welfarism aligns with our passionate focus on citizens and workers’ welfare.”
